#8051c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8051c2 is composed of 50.2% red, 31.8%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34% cyan, 58.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 265 degrees, a saturation of 48.1% and a lightness of 53.9%. #8051c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#010085.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

● #8051c2 color description : Moderate violet.
#8051c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8051c2 has RGB values of R:128, G:81,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 8409538.
